Having a problem, i have been trying to make the notification pulldown transparent and i made the png transparent, but now it just shows a black background. So i'm assuming there is a second background controled by a xml file or another png. Does anyone know what i have to edit to get it fully transparent?
FIXED
Reserved for my use.
http://forum.xda-developers.com/showthread.php?t=748868&highlight=Transparent
2.2 requires an .xml edit in the services.jar to allow transparency in the notification background.

I love the theme . But quick question , how are you changing the colors of the signal bars in the status bar ? I have tried and tried but once i pull them out GIMP2 only lets me darken them not change the color . I already know I must be doing it wrong so any help would be nice .
cbrown245 said:
I love the theme . But quick question , how are you changing the colors of the signal bars in the status bar ? I have tried and tried but once i pull them out GIMP2 only lets me darken them not change the color . I already know I must be doing it wrong so any help would be nice .
Click to expand...
Click to collapse
What!!!!! your asking me to give away my trade secrets? Just Kidding!!!! In gimp right click png go to image=mode=switch to RGB mode. Now u should be set to change color.
Also quick note Not sure if u know but the signal bars are actually in the com.htc.resources.apk and are named cdma_sys_6signal_X
